1、分析原因,可能因?yàn)槠脚_(tái)遷移碰到權(quán)限問(wèn)題我們來(lái)進(jìn)行權(quán)限轉(zhuǎn)換 1)在Windows下轉(zhuǎn)換:利用一些編輯器如UltraEdit或EditPlus等工具先將腳本編碼轉(zhuǎn)換,再放到Linux中執(zhí)行。
創(chuàng)新互聯(lián)專(zhuān)注為客戶提供全方位的互聯(lián)網(wǎng)綜合服務(wù),包含不限于做網(wǎng)站、網(wǎng)站設(shè)計(jì)、鄱陽(yáng)網(wǎng)絡(luò)推廣、重慶小程序開(kāi)發(fā)公司、鄱陽(yáng)網(wǎng)絡(luò)營(yíng)銷(xiāo)、鄱陽(yáng)企業(yè)策劃、鄱陽(yáng)品牌公關(guān)、搜索引擎seo、人物專(zhuān)訪、企業(yè)宣傳片、企業(yè)代運(yùn)營(yíng)等,從售前售中售后,我們都將竭誠(chéng)為您服務(wù),您的肯定,是我們最大的嘉獎(jiǎng);創(chuàng)新互聯(lián)為所有大學(xué)生創(chuàng)業(yè)者提供鄱陽(yáng)建站搭建服務(wù),24小時(shí)服務(wù)熱線:18980820575,官方網(wǎng)址:aaarwkj.com
2、原因是系統(tǒng)位數(shù)與該可執(zhí)行文件需要的lib庫(kù)位數(shù)不匹配。用uname命令打印系統(tǒng)信息,發(fā)現(xiàn)系統(tǒng)是64位系統(tǒng)。用file命令查看文件信息,發(fā)現(xiàn)是一個(gè)32位可執(zhí)行文件。要想在64位系統(tǒng)上與運(yùn)行32位程序,則需要安裝32位lib庫(kù)。
3、原因是linux 執(zhí)行sh文件里面缺少PATH=$PATH:/sbin,添加進(jìn)即可。首先需要打開(kāi)電腦的桌面,如圖所示,鼠標(biāo)右鍵單擊選擇打開(kāi)終端的選項(xiàng)。然后就會(huì)進(jìn)入頁(yè)面,如圖所示,在命令行輸入 gedit /etc/profile,回車(chē)。
原因是linux 執(zhí)行sh文件里面缺少PATH=$PATH:/sbin,添加進(jìn)即可。首先需要打開(kāi)電腦的桌面,如圖所示,鼠標(biāo)右鍵單擊選擇打開(kāi)終端的選項(xiàng)。然后就會(huì)進(jìn)入頁(yè)面,如圖所示,在命令行輸入 gedit /etc/profile,回車(chē)。
出現(xiàn)此問(wèn)題的原因:linux 執(zhí)行sh文件里面缺少PATH=$PATH:/sbin,將其添加進(jìn)即可解決問(wèn)題。詳細(xì)的操作步驟如下:首先,需要打開(kāi)計(jì)算機(jī)的桌面,右鍵單擊并選擇“打開(kāi)終端”這一項(xiàng),如下圖所示。
not found帶這個(gè)的行,是前面的可執(zhí)行程序沒(méi)有安裝。No such file or directory帶這個(gè)的行,是前面的文件找不到。懷疑你這個(gè)是從redhat或者centos發(fā)行版的linux上拷貝的腳本,放到debian系,比如ubuntu系統(tǒng)上去執(zhí)行了。
)在Windows下轉(zhuǎn)換:利用一些編輯器如UltraEdit或EditPlus等工具先將腳本編碼轉(zhuǎn)換,再放到Linux中執(zhí)行。轉(zhuǎn)換方式如下(UltraEdit):File--Conversions--DOS-UNIX即可。
linux怎么運(yùn)行.sh需要3個(gè)步驟來(lái)完成,下面是具體介紹:找到文件所在目錄,cd到.sh文件所在目錄。給.sh文件添加執(zhí)行權(quán)限,用chmodu添加權(quán)限。用sh執(zhí)行.sh文件。今天的分享就是這些,希望能幫助大家。
下載你想要安裝的軟件。將壓縮包里的內(nèi)容解壓到桌面上。打開(kāi)終端程序。讓.sh文件變成可執(zhí)行文件。最后,運(yùn)行.sh文件。完成程序的安裝。
第二種方式是賦予sh文件可執(zhí)行權(quán)限,然后直接運(yùn)行它。
a.sh然后運(yùn)行文件就可以了./a.sh這樣運(yùn)行是a.sh在當(dāng)前工作目錄,如果文件沒(méi)在當(dāng)前目錄,那么就需要用絕對(duì)路徑來(lái)執(zhí)行,比如/opt/a.sh ,/opt/test/a.sh,如果想知道更多的linux相關(guān)可以關(guān)注《linux就該這么學(xué)》這本書(shū)。
Linux下面運(yùn)行 SH文件步驟如下:查看目錄sh文件。先給文件添加x權(quán)限chmod u+x hello.sh。然后再輸入./hello,sh或 sh hello.sh。執(zhí)行hello.sh文件。
linux怎么運(yùn)行.sh需要3個(gè)步驟來(lái)完成,下面是具體介紹:找到文件所在目錄,cd到.sh文件所在目錄。給.sh文件添加執(zhí)行權(quán)限,用chmodu添加權(quán)限。用sh執(zhí)行.sh文件。今天的分享就是這些,希望能幫助大家。
步驟一:登錄Linux服務(wù)器。打開(kāi)Xshell,新建會(huì)話輸入相應(yīng)的主機(jī)名稱和IP,登錄Linux服務(wù)器。圖1:登錄Linux服務(wù)器 如果連接Linux失敗的話,可以參考教程:Xshell如何遠(yuǎn)程連接Linux服務(wù)器。步驟二:查看lrzsz是否已經(jīng)安裝。
首先給test.sh可執(zhí)行權(quán)限如test,sh文件在/home/work文件下。其次本身目錄下運(yùn)行進(jìn)入cd/home/workwen文件下。最后執(zhí)行./test.sh命令會(huì)在當(dāng)前目錄下創(chuàng)建一個(gè)“test”目錄健康教育了。
網(wǎng)站名稱:linux命令行修改sh linux命令行修改文件內(nèi)容怎么修改
網(wǎng)站路徑:http://aaarwkj.com/article21/dieiscd.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站維護(hù)、網(wǎng)站改版、微信公眾號(hào)、做網(wǎng)站、移動(dòng)網(wǎng)站建設(shè)、網(wǎng)站內(nèi)鏈
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)